If you have never tried a certain over-the-counter antihistamine yet, do so when you are home. Many antihistamines can cause people to feel drowsy and inhibit their different reflexes. Even if the packaging does not contain a warning, when you take the first couple of doses, do it during a time that you are able to stay home and see how it makes you feel.

Grab a shower before going to bed; make sure you also wash your hair. As the day goes by you are slowly collecting pollen on your clothes and on your body, so to prevent yourself from being woken at night by a reaction it is best to clean yourself. A long shower is not necessary, you just need to rinse off to avoid any negative reaction.

If you experience your allergy symptoms like clockwork, keep track of the time. Pollen is most oppressive between 5 and 10 o’clock in the morning, so it is wise to avoid the outdoors during these hours.If you have to leave the house, try not to stay out for very long and limit your activity.

Age can actually play an important role in your allergy profile. For instance, babies experience proteins first through the food they eat, and that explains how many food allergies some babies can have. As they age, they may become tolerant of some allergens, and can become sensitive to new ones as they are introduced to them. If your son or daughter appears to show signs of pollen or spore allergies, be sure not to disregard the possibility of an allergic reaction just because there were no previous signs of a problem.

Think about removing carpet from your home. Carpet is known to collect dust mites, pollen and pet dander. If your home is carpeted throughout, you might look into other flooring options; tile, wood and linoleum are all far easier on your allergies. This will reduce the amount of allergens in your home. If you are unable to do this, make certain to run your vacuum daily.

Be aware of the stress you are under. Many people are not aware that their stress can affect their susceptibility to allergy attacks. This holds true for individuals with asthma. The risk of an attack increases when the increase in their stress level rises. While less stress won’t cure an allergy, it can make their symptoms less severe and help attacks pass more quickly.

Those dealing with allergies should use the vacuum regularly. Vacuuming reduces allergens in the air. Make sure you check on your vacuum is still doing its job.An older vacuum may release some allergens back in the environment. Vacuums that are newer contain HEPA filters that trap virtually all allergens from spreading through the air.
